Refunds
Program fees are refundable if requests
are made at least one week prior to the first day of classes, for
classes the YMCA cancels, and for documented medical reasons. Unless the
YMCA cancels a class, a $10 processing fee is charged for all refunds.
Membership
Fees are not refundable.

Program Registration
Members are entitled to register
for the following YMCA programs and activities: YMCA Youth Sports, Teen
Strength Training, Computer Classes, Dance Classes, Art Classes,
Preschool Enrichment (Tumble Tots), and YMCA Swim Lessons: Parent/Child,
Preschool
and Youth. Prior to each Program Session, the following opportunities
for registration are
available:
Priority Registration is for members who are currently
participating in programs, and occurs approximately three weeks prior to
the beginning of a new session. Members may only register for programs
scheduled on the same day and time as currently registered.
Change Days occur after all priority participants have had the
opportunity to register, and are available for those wishing to transfer
registration to another day and/or time, without incurring the $10.00
change fee.
Family Priority Registration is for those holding Family
Memberships, and who are not currently enrolled in programs and
activities. Only eligible members may register during these two days,
approximately two weeks prior to a new session.
Open Registration begins with a one-day event, held Saturdays,
for those members and non-members wishing to register for YMCA programs
and activities. Non-members may purchase memberships at this time.
Registration begins at 8:00 a.m. Those wishing to
register for youth swim lessons (our largest program) may wish to arrive
early. Registrations are taken by number (first come, first served) and
numbers are given out beginning at 7:00 a.m. when the building opens.
Open Registration continues through the beginning of the session.
Program registration will not be accepted after the fourth week of
classes.
NOTE; If you
have a child currently enrolled in a class and would like to enroll a
sibling, please contact
the Program Director of that particular program (e.g. Aquatic Director)
for special sibling priority
registration.

Emergency Closings
The YMCA will make every effort to announce emergency program
cancellations and closures on the top of the Home Page of this website
(although there may be exceptions when we are unable to post in time).
Swimming lesson participants who have provided us with email contact
information, will receive an email notification. For closures related
to inclement weather, including lightning and thunder that close the
pool temporarily, we will offer make-up classes during buddy swim week.
Class credits will only be issued in the event that we have to cancel
swimming lessons on a particular day, more than once in a session.
Refunds will not be issued.

Payment Methods:
Personal Checks for
more than $10.00 are accepted with a valid driver’s license and one
major credit card as identification.
Credit Cards may
be used to purchase memberships, program registrations or sales items.
VISA, MasterCard and American Express are accepted.
Monthly Credit Card
Draft allows one-twelfth of your annual membership to be charged
automatically to your VISA, MasterCard or American Express account each month. Draft
payments are continuous, do not end after one year, and renewal
reminders are not issued. The Initiation Fee is added to the first
month’s payment amount. All changes to your credit card account
status, including receiving a replacement card for an expired credit
card, should be immediately reported to Cheryl Cappello ext. 21 so that
your account does not unnecessarily or mistakenly fall into arrears
(which causes us to cancel your membership). Cancellation
requests must be received by the last day of the month in order to avoid
the next month's automatic draft payment. All current
membership cards must accompany a completed Draft Termination Form to
complete the termination.
